Job Description

Established in 1951, IOM is the leading inter-governmental organization in the field of migration and works closely with governmental, inter-governmental, and non-governmental partners. With 175 member states, a further 8 states holding observer status and offices in over 100 countries, IOM, the UN Migration Agency, is dedicated to promoting humane and orderly migration for the benefit of all. It does so by providing services and advice to governments and migrants. Brazil is a Member State of IOM since 2004.
